Database là gì? Cơ sở dữ liệu và những vấn đề liên quan bạn cần biết

Database là gì? Database là cụm từ được sử dụng nhiều trong giới công nghệ thông tin, dữ liệu, lập trình phần mềm, lập trình website, … Database dịch ra tiếng Việt có nghĩa là cơ sở dữ liệu, các dữ liệu thường dùng như bảng biểu, lược đồ, truy vấn, báo cáo, những đối tượng khác, …  Vậy Database là gì? Cơ sở dữ liệu là gì?

Database là gì? Cơ sở dữ liệu và những vấn đề liên quan bạn cần biết

Để hiểu rõ hơn về Database là gì? Cơ sở dữ liệu, bài viết sau đây chúng tôi sẽ cùng bạn đọc tìm hiểu.

Database là gì?

Database là một bộ sưu tập dữ liệu có hệ thống. Cơ sở dữ liệu hỗ trợ lưu trữ và thao tác dữ liệu. Cơ sở dữ liệu giúp quản lý dữ liệu dễ dàng. Hãy thảo luận về một vài ví dụ.

Một thư mục điện thoại trực tuyến chắc chắn sẽ sử dụng cơ sở dữ liệu để lưu trữ dữ liệu liên quan đến mọi người, số điện thoại, chi tiết liên lạc khác, v.v.

Nhà cung cấp dịch vụ điện của bạn rõ ràng đang sử dụng cơ sở dữ liệu để quản lý hóa đơn, các vấn đề liên quan đến khách hàng, để xử lý dữ liệu lỗi, v.v.

Chúng ta cũng hãy xem xét facebook. Nó cần lưu trữ, thao tác và trình bày dữ liệu liên quan đến thành viên, bạn bè của họ, hoạt động của thành viên, tin nhắn, quảng cáo và nhiều hơn nữa.

Database là gì?

Hệ thống quản lý Database (DBMS) là gì?

Hệ thống quản lý cơ sở dữ liệu (DBMS) là tập hợp các chương trình cho phép người dùng truy cập cơ sở dữ liệu, thao tác dữ liệu, báo cáo / biểu diễn dữ liệu.

Nó cũng giúp kiểm soát truy cập vào cơ sở dữ liệu.

Hệ thống quản lý cơ sở dữ liệu không phải là một khái niệm mới và như vậy đã được thực hiện lần đầu tiên vào những năm 1960.

Cửa hàng dữ liệu tích hợp của Charles Bachmen (IDS) của được cho là DBMS đầu tiên trong lịch sử.

Với thời gian, các công nghệ cơ sở dữ liệu đã phát triển rất nhiều trong khi việc sử dụng và các chức năng dự kiến ​​của cơ sở dữ liệu đã được tăng lên rất nhiều.

Hệ thống quản lý Database (DBMS) là gì?

Các loại DBMS

Chúng ta hãy xem gia đình DBMS đã phát triển như thế nào với thời gian. Sơ đồ sau cho thấy sự phát triển của các loại DBMS.

Có 4 loại DBMS chính. Hãy xem xét chi tiết chúng.

  • Phân cấp (Hierarchical) - loại DBMS này sử dụng mối quan hệ "cha-con" của việc lưu trữ dữ liệu. Loại DBMS này ngày nay hiếm khi được sử dụng. Cấu trúc của nó giống như một cái cây với các nút đại diện cho các bản ghi và các nhánh đại diện cho các trường. Sổ đăng ký windows được sử dụng trong Windows XP là một ví dụ về cơ sở dữ liệu phân cấp. Cài đặt cấu hình được lưu trữ dưới dạng cấu trúc cây với các nút.

  • DBMS mạng (network DBM) - loại DBMS này hỗ trợ nhiều mối quan hệ. Điều này thường dẫn đến các cấu trúc cơ sở dữ liệu phức tạp. Máy chủ RDM là một ví dụ về hệ thống quản lý cơ sở dữ liệu thực hiện mô hình mạng.

  • DBMS quan hệ (Relational DBMS) - loại DBMS này xác định các mối quan hệ cơ sở dữ liệu dưới dạng bảng, còn được gọi là quan hệ. Không giống như DBMS mạng, RDBMS không hỗ trợ nhiều mối quan hệ. DBMS quan hệ thường có các kiểu dữ liệu được xác định trước mà chúng có thể hỗ trợ. Đây là loại DBMS phổ biến nhất trên thị trường. Ví dụ về các hệ thống quản lý cơ sở dữ liệu quan hệ bao gồm cơ sở dữ liệu MySQL, Oracle và Microsoft SQL Server.

  • DBMS Relative Relative DBMS - loại này hỗ trợ lưu trữ các loại dữ liệu mới. Dữ liệu được lưu trữ ở dạng đối tượng. Các đối tượng được lưu trữ trong cơ sở dữ liệu có các thuộc tính (ví dụ như giới tính, ager) và các phương thức xác định những việc cần làm với dữ liệu. PostgreSQL là một ví dụ về DBMS quan hệ hướng đối tượng.

SQL là gì?

Ngôn ngữ truy vấn có cấu trúc (SQL) được phát âm là "SQL" hoặc đôi khi là "See-Quel " thực sự là ngôn ngữ tiêu chuẩn để xử lý Cơ sở dữ liệu quan hệ.

Lập trình SQL có thể được sử dụng một cách hiệu quả để chèn, tìm kiếm, cập nhật, xóa các bản ghi cơ sở dữ liệu.

Điều đó không có nghĩa là SQL không thể làm những việc vượt quá điều đó.

Trong thực tế, nó có thể làm rất nhiều thứ bao gồm, nhưng không giới hạn, tối ưu hóa và bảo trì cơ sở dữ liệu.

Các cơ sở dữ liệu quan hệ như Cơ sở dữ liệu MySQL, Oracle, máy chủ Ms SQL, Sybase, v.v ... sử dụng SQL! Làm thế nào để sử dụng cú pháp sql?

Các cú pháp SQL được sử dụng trong các cơ sở dữ liệu này gần như tương tự nhau, ngoại trừ thực tế là một số đang sử dụng một số cú pháp khác nhau và thậm chí các cú pháp SQL độc quyền.

SQL là gì?

NoQuery là gì?

NoQuery là một thể loại sắp tới của Hệ thống quản lý cơ sở dữ liệu. Đặc điểm chính của nó là không tuân thủ các khái niệm cơ sở dữ liệu quan hệ. NOSQL có nghĩa là "Không chỉ SQL".

Khái niệm về cơ sở dữ liệu NoQuery đã phát triển với những người khổng lồ internet như Google, Facebook, Amazon, v.v., những người đối phó với khối lượng dữ liệu khổng lồ.

Khi bạn sử dụng cơ sở dữ liệu quan hệ cho khối lượng dữ liệu khổng lồ, hệ thống bắt đầu chậm về thời gian phản hồi.

Để khắc phục điều này, tất nhiên chúng tôi có thể "mở rộng" hệ thống của mình bằng cách nâng cấp phần cứng hiện có.

Giải pháp thay thế cho vấn đề trên sẽ là phân phối tải cơ sở dữ liệu của chúng tôi trên nhiều máy chủ khi tải tăng lên.

Điều này được gọi là "nhân rộng".

Cơ sở dữ liệu NOSQL là cơ sở dữ liệu không liên quan that scale out better than relational databases and are designed with web applications in mind.

Wordpress là gì?

Wordpress là gì?

Khái niệm Wordpress

Nói một cách đơn giản, WordPress là phần mềm bạn có thể sử dụng để tạo trang web, blog hoặc thậm chí là một ứng dụng của riêng bạn. Kể từ khi được phát hành lần đầu tiên vào năm 2003, WordPress đã phát triển thành một hệ thống quản lý nội dung có tính linh hoạt cao, hay còn gọi là CMS. Và ngày nay, nó cung cấp sức mạnh cho hơn 27% toàn bộ web, bao gồm một số trang web phổ biến nhất mà bạn có thể đã nghe nói đến.

WordPress cho phép bạn xây dựng và quản lý trang web đầy đủ tính năng của riêng bạn chỉ bằng trình duyệt web của bạn mà không cần phải học cách viết mã. Thực tế, nếu bạn đã từng sử dụng trình soạn thảo văn bản như Microsoft Word, bạn sẽ ở nhà ngay với Trình chỉnh sửa WordPress.

Vậy, WordPress hoạt động như thế nào?

Để bắt đầu sử dụng WordPress, trước tiên bạn sẽ tải xuống phần mềm, cài đặt nó trên máy chủ web, kết nối nó với cơ sở dữ liệu và sau đó bắt đầu xuất bản nội dung của bạn trên web. Nghe có vẻ phức tạp, nhưng toàn bộ quá trình mất khoảng 5 phút. Và sau khi cài đặt, nó cho phép bạn sử dụng một trình soạn thảo đơn giản, dựa trên web để xuất bản nội dung và xây dựng trang web của bạn. Thậm chí còn có một phiên bản được lưu trữ tại WordPress.com cho phép bạn tạo một trang web hỗ trợ WordPress mới chỉ trong vài giây.

Có một số lý do WordPress là một lựa chọn tuyệt vời để xây dựng trang web blog hoặc doanh nghiệp của bạn.

  • Trước hết, WordPress được phân phối theo giấy phép Nguồn mở - có nghĩa là bạn có thể tải xuống và sử dụng phần mềm WordPress theo cách bạn thích miễn phí. Nhưng nó cũng có nghĩa là hàng trăm tình nguyện viên trên khắp thế giới không ngừng tạo ra và cải thiện phần mềm WordPress.

  • Thứ hai, WordPress rất dễ học và sử dụng - Thay vì thuê một nhà thiết kế web mỗi khi bạn muốn thực hiện một thay đổi nhỏ cho trang web của mình, bạn có thể dễ dàng quản lý và cập nhật nội dung của mình bằng cách sử dụng các công cụ định dạng cơ bản mà bạn có thể đã quen thuộc.

  • Thứ ba, nó hoàn toàn có thể tùy chỉnh - Có hàng ngàn chủ đề và plugin cho phép bạn dễ dàng thay đổi toàn bộ giao diện trang web của bạn hoặc thậm chí thêm các tính năng mới vào trang web của bạn chỉ bằng vài cú nhấp chuột.


  • Tiếp theo, nếu bạn gặp vấn đề hoặc bạn muốn thêm các tính năng tùy chỉnh, thật dễ dàng để tìm hỗ trợ hoặc thuê ai đó giúp bạn. Ngoài các hướng dẫn về WordPress trên trang web này, còn có hàng ngàn nhà phát triển và thiết kế WordPress có thể giúp bạn. Diễn đàn WordPress chính thức là một nơi tuyệt vời để có câu trả lời cho câu hỏi của bạn. Và mỗi năm, có hàng ngàn sự kiện WordPress địa phương diễn ra trên toàn thế giới nơi bạn có thể gặp và nói chuyện với những người dùng WordPress khác.


  • Cuối cùng, bạn đang kiểm soát nội dung của riêng bạn . Một số nền tảng xuất bản khác giới hạn những gì bạn có thể và không thể làm trên trang web của riêng bạn. Và, bạn đang bị khóa trong dịch vụ đó; nếu cần tắt, nội dung của bạn có thể biến mất. Với WordPress, bạn có thể nhập dữ liệu của mình từ các nền tảng khác như Blogger hoặc Tumblr và bạn có thể dễ dàng xuất dữ liệu của mình để di chuyển khỏi WordPress, bất cứ lúc nào bạn chọn. Bạn đang kiểm soát nội dung của bạn.